Remove deprecated ActiveRecord::ConnectionAdapters::AbstractAdapter#supports_multi_insert?

This commit is contained in:
Rafael Mendonça França 2020-05-07 15:36:59 -04:00
parent ea32fe3de4
commit cbf43df288
No known key found for this signature in database
GPG Key ID: FC23B6D0F1EEE948
4 changed files with 6 additions and 10 deletions

@ -1,3 +1,7 @@
* Remove deprecated `ActiveRecord::ConnectionAdapters::AbstractAdapter#supports_multi_insert?`.
*Rafael Mendonça França*
* Remove deprecated `ActiveRecord::ConnectionAdapters::AbstractAdapter#supports_foreign_keys_in_create?`.
*Rafael Mendonça França*

@ -370,12 +370,6 @@ def supports_comments_in_create?
false
end
# Does this adapter support multi-value insert?
def supports_multi_insert?
true
end
deprecate :supports_multi_insert?
# Does this adapter support virtual columns?
def supports_virtual_columns?
false

@ -332,10 +332,6 @@ def test_select_methods_passing_a_relation
assert_equal "special_db_type", @connection.type_to_sql(:special_db_type)
end
def test_supports_multi_insert_is_deprecated
assert_deprecated { @connection.supports_multi_insert? }
end
def test_column_name_length_is_deprecated
assert_deprecated { @connection.column_name_length }
end

@ -149,6 +149,8 @@ Please refer to the [Changelog][active-record] for detailed changes.
### Removals
* Remove deprecated `ActiveRecord::ConnectionAdapters::AbstractAdapter#supports_multi_insert?`.
* Remove deprecated `ActiveRecord::ConnectionAdapters::AbstractAdapter#supports_foreign_keys_in_create?`.
* Remove deprecated `ActiveRecord::ConnectionAdapters::PostgreSQLAdapter#supports_ranges?`.